The letter " A " is distinct for its slightly cut top, and other characters, like the " E ," feature rounded top-left angles to provide a streamlined look reminiscent of vehicle aerodynamics.

The original wordmark used all-caps, light lettering with perfectly circular "O"s.

The most defining feature of the Ashok Leyland font is the connected If you look closely, the horizontal bar of the first "L" extends seamlessly to become the vertical spine of the second "L." This ligature is a stroke of design genius. It creates a visual link that suggests continuity, connectivity, and forward motion. It turns a standard word into a unique, trademarked symbol. ashok leyland font
